    • In a Morgan Descendancy chart posted on the internet, the nickname "Jefferson" was shown for John Walter Powell. Carolyn Powell Lockhart indicates that her great grandfather was John Walter Powell, and that to her knowledge he was never called by that nickname. Carolyn indicated that he remarried after his wife's death and he and his second wife moved to Merryville. Ruby Burkett notes that If Martha Ann died on March 23, 1913, there is some confusing information here. Her family story was that when "Aunt Minnie Maysel Boyett was married to Andy Arrington Fuller on May 13, 1913, they moved into a two room apartment in the home of her Aunt and uncle Martha Ann and Walter Powell in Merryville. Martha Ann was known as Aunt Babe. Their home was just behind, what I supose, is the present City Hall in Merryville. Of course much has changed in Merryville. I can assume that Martha Ann was dear to my grand-mother, Henrietta Jones Boyett, because she named one of her daughters Martha Ann and she was also called Babe"

      His Texas Death Certificate shows that although he was a resident of Merryville, LA at the time of his death, he died in Voth, Texas. His father was shown as John Powell, born in Arkansas, and his mother, Lucy Thomas, born in Texas.
